Output 1377e323d6d018d5f242cf5ed626b62836c4c6186b1ad2a17206b6913df9241a:139

value
756630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77bf9098d04c8b498605358402dfdea6b66892fb OP_EQUAL
address
3CcBpXfF8unDQtFXZU3RmTM3XG3DcC7XXH
transaction
1377e323d6d018d5f242cf5ed626b62836c4c6186b1ad2a17206b6913df9241a
spent
true